What Happens to Your Body in High-Heat Environments?

Being in a hot environment, such as a sauna or hot bath, increases your body's temperature. This rise in body temperature causes your heart rate to increase, your blood vessels to dilate, and your body to start sweating to maintain its temperature.


However, high body temperatures may disrupt activities that require balance, such as hormone production, ovulation, and spermatogenesis (the process of producing sperm). While occasional sauna use may be safe, it's best not to overdo it, as frequent exposure to high temperatures can reduce fertility and may not be advisable when trying to conceive.


Heat Exposure and Male Fertility: What's the Link?

In males, fertility depends on maintaining the right body temperature. The fact that your testicles are outside your body is because they need a temperature somewhat lower than your body's core for sperm development. Frequent exposure to hot temperatures can upset the balance in several ways:


  • Reduced sperm count: Studies have shown that frequent use of hot tubs or saunas can lead to a temporary drop in sperm concentration.
  • Lower motility: Heat can impair the ability of sperm to move efficiently, which is essential for fertilising an egg.
  • DNA fragmentation: Prolonged exposure to heat has been linked to increased DNA damage in sperm cells, which can impact their quality and viability.
It should be pointed out that many of these effects can be reversed. Eliminating or reducing exposure usually allows sperm production to recover in about two to three months, which is the average sperm production cycle.


Female Fertility and Heat Exposure: Is There a Concern?

Internal reproductive organs are more insulated from external heat and are less affected by environmental heat. However, prolonged elevation of core body temperature may still pose theoretical concerns, especially in early pregnancy.

Here's what to consider:

  • Ovulation timing: High internal temperatures may interfere with luteinising hormone (LH) surges, potentially affecting ovulation cycles.
  • Implantation sensitivity: While implantation itself is not proven to be highly heat-sensitive, maintaining a normal uterine environment is considered ideal during this critical window.
  • Pregnancy caution: During early pregnancy, exposure to saunas or hot baths above 39°C (102.2°F) has been associated with an increased risk of neural tube defects in some studies.
Although direct evidence is limited, it may be wise to avoid prolonged heat exposure during ovulation or fertility treatments such as IVF, as a precautionary measure.


What About Steam Rooms and Infrared Saunas?

Although steam rooms seem gentler, they can reach the same core body temperature as dry saunas. Infrared saunas heat the body directly and may feel milder, but they can still raise tissue temperatures. However, their impact on core temperature is typically less dramatic than that of traditional saunas. The overall fertility risks depend more on the rise in core body temperature than on the type of heat source.


How Long Is Too Long?

Having a hot soak or using a sauna from time to time shouldn't upset your plans for children. Most of the risk comes from the frequency and duration of the exposure. Here are the things you should watch for:

  • Limit sauna or steam room use to 15 minutes or less.
  • Avoid water above 39°C (102.2°F)
  • Skip daily hot tubs or back-to-back sessions.
  • Allow your body at least 48 hours to recover between heat exposures.

Short, occasional exposures are unlikely to have lasting effects. But if you're regularly using these services, especially during conception efforts, moderation becomes crucial.


Safe Alternatives for Relaxation

You don't have to give up the relaxation rituals you love; consider modifying them:

  • Switch to warm (not hot) baths at a temperature of under 37°C for shorter durations.
  • Opt for warm compresses for muscle relief instead of full-body heat.
  • Practice mindfulness or meditation as stress-reducing alternatives.
  • Try lukewarm foot soaks, which offer relaxation without impacting core temperature.

These methods can help you maintain wellness without compromising fertility-related goals.

FAQs on Do Saunas, Steam Rooms, or Hot Baths Affect Fertility

  1. Can one sauna session lower fertility in men?
    A single sauna session is unlikely to cause lasting fertility damage. However, repeated use, especially several times per week, may temporarily reduce sperm count and quality. If you're trying to conceive, it's safer to use saunas occasionally and for short durations.
  2. Is it safe for women to take hot baths during ovulation?
    Hot baths above 39°C (102.2°F) should be avoided during ovulation or early pregnancy. They may affect ovulation signals or the uterine environment. Opt for warm (not hot) baths at a temperature of under 37°C to stay on the safe side.
  3. Do heat-related fertility effects reverse once exposure stops?
    Yes, in most cases, fertility issues related to heat, particularly in men, are temporary. Sperm production usually returns to normal within 2–3 months after reducing or stopping heat exposure.
